Use the same date and path

This commit is contained in:
Blade of Darkness 2020-12-19 18:44:38 +01:00
parent 09eff5b268
commit 4e2d7e92bb
1 changed files with 10 additions and 7 deletions

View File

@ -1,6 +1,9 @@
#!/bin/bash
mysqldump --all-databases > /var/backups/all_databases.sql
DATE=$(date +%Y%m%d)
PATH='/var/backups'
mysqldump --all-databases > $PATH/all_databases.sql
tar -cvz \
--exclude ".nobackup" \
@ -20,11 +23,11 @@ tar -cvz \
/var/lib/bzflag/ \
/var/spool/cron/ \
/var/spool/anacron/ \
/var/backups/all_databases.sql \
-f /var/backups/`date +%Y%m%d`.tgz
$PATH/all_databases.sql \
-f $PATH/$DATE.tgz
chown root:sudo /var/backups/$(date +%Y%m%d).tgz
chmod 640 /var/backups/*.tgz
chown root:sudo $PATH/$DATE.tgz
chmod 640 $PATH/*.tgz
find /var/backups -name "*.tgz" -mtime +3 -exec rm {} \;
rm /var/backups/all_databases.sql
find $PATH -name "*.tgz" -mtime +3 -exec rm {} \;
rm $PATH/all_databases.sql